Kurruru is one of Australia’s leading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ander arts program. Inspired by Aunty Josie Agius and originally called 'Port Youth', Kurruru, now a program of Kura Yerlo Inc, is committed to supporting the ongoing maintenance of culture, community and identity through the provision of quality arts opportunities for children, young people. Kurruru is a grass roots program off

ered through Kura Yerlo Inc, an Aboriginal Community Controlled Organisation in Port Adelaide and is a nationally recognised leader in the creation of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Art.

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Family-Led Decision Making is a family-led approach that supports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ander families to make decisions about their children in culturally safe ways.

It strengthens culture, family connections, children and young people's voices and is linked with better care planning and stronger kinship outcomes.
